    x = (-0.21 +/- sqrt(0.21^2 - 4(-1)(50))) / (2(-1)) x = (-0.21 +/- sqrt(0.0441 + 200)) / (-2) x = (-0.21 +/- sqrt(200.0441)) / (-2) x = 0.105 +/- sqrt(50.011025) x =~ 7.1768473541218351158987103473991 or -6.9668473541218351158987103473991
